一、如何调试WebStorm

WebStorm是一款优秀的JavaScript开发工具,被大多数的JS开发人员誉为最智能的JavaSscript IDE。对于使用的不用的操作系统对WebStorm更改一下设置,能够在更大的程度上提升效率。

JavaScript开发工具WebStorm教程:如何调试WebStorm

webstorm 如何调试WebStorm

JavaScript是一种基于对象和事件驱动,且具有相对安全性的客户端脚本语言,也是时下最为流行的Web脚本语言。目前也在积极的扩展应用领域,同时基于Javascript开发的游戏也在不断增加。另一方面也以JavaScipt为目标而诞生了多种其他语言,如有着更高精简性与可读性的CoffeeScript语言,以及为大型应用服务的ypeScript语言等。

最新的TIOBE编程语言6月的排行榜上,JavaScript也重新进入前十名,目前JavaScript语言依旧处于在TIOBE编程语言排行榜上的一个上升趋势,依旧很具有潜力。

对于优秀的编程语言选择合适的开发工具,就能够事半功倍。jetbrains公司旗下的WebStorm是一款优秀的JavaScript开发工具,被大多数的JS开发人员誉为最智能的JavaSscript IDE。

WebStorm更改设置

对于使用的不用的操作系统对WebStorm更改一下设置,能够在更大的程度上提升效率。

webstorm 如何调试WebStorm

1、Windows系统

<WebStorm installation folder>/bin/idea.exe.vmoptions

或是下面的方法进行设置:

<WebStorm installation folder>/bin/idea64.exe.vmoptions

2、*NIX系统

<WebStorm installation folder>/bin/idea.vmoptions

或是下面的方法进行设置:

<WebStorm installation folder>/bin/idea64.vmoptions

3、Mac操作系统

将这个file/Applications/WebStorm.app/bin/下的idea.vmoptions复制到

~/Library/Preferences/WebIdeXX/idea.vmoptions

举个例子,为了增加WebStorm堆的大小,你需要从/Applications/WebStorm.app/bin/idea.vmoptions复制original.vmoptions文件到~/Library/Preferences/WebIdeXX/idea.vmoptions,然后修改-Xmx设置。

对于比较旧的版本的话,就需要如下进行设置存储:

/Applications/WebStorm.app/Contents/Info.plist

Unicode文本的管理设置

在WebStorm允许定义非ascii字符是否应该使用文字像‘\ u00AB’或‘\ 00 ab”。

中操作主要是由系统属性idea.native2ascii.lowercase控制,在默认的情况下,使用大写字符。

也可以使用小写字符,但是需要按照使用的平台进行设置,如下:

1、Windows和*NIX系统

idea.native2ascii.lowercase=true

放到bin/idea.properties文件,这个文件位于产品装包中。

2、Mac操作系统

复制/Applications/WebStorm.app/bin/idea.properties文件到~/Library/Preferences/WebIdeXX/下,打开进行编辑,添加行。

对于老版本的WebStorm,打开用于编辑的/Applications/WebStorm.app/Contents/Info.plist文件,并添加以下代码:

<key>idea.native2ascii.lowercase</key>

<string>true</string>

到这个部分

<key>Properties</key><dict>...<dict>

放到bin/idea.properties文件,这个文件位于产品装包中。

二、webstorm,web前端开发是干嘛的

Web前端开始是自从2005年后互联网进入了web2.0时代而出现的大量相似于桌面软件的web,相对来说是一个比较新的由网页制作演变过来的职业。那web前端开发到底具体的工作是做什么的?

如今的网页不再只是单一的图片和文字结合,各类丰富的媒体让网页展现出来的内容更加的生动形象,而基于前端技术实现的网页上软件化则是会为了用户更好的使用体验,前端开发的技术也会越来越难。

有码互联紧随着时代发展的趋势,及时调整web前端开发课程的开设结构,web前端开发的工程师既要跟上游的视觉设计师、交互设计师以及产品经理沟通,还要和下游的服务器端工程师沟通。因此掌握的技能技巧是非常之多的。因此web前端开发设计师在知识的广度上也有了更高的要求,若想精一行,必先懂十行。十全十美的人毕竟是少有的,对于其它的知识要有懂,宁可不全会,也不要全不会。

对于小白初想入行的小白来说,学习专业的web前端知识,要找对培训机构是非常重要的。有码互联还是挺好的,一般学习的都是3-4个月的学习,然后有2个月实训,这样下来就会增加自己的一些实战能力。想要学好web前端设计的话,可以了解看看。

Web前端到如今也是有十几年了吧,那为什么web依旧是这么火呢?

如果是计算机相关专业的学生肯定都知道“程序员/工程师”这个职业,web前端也是被大众认为“开发工程师/程序员”。

我们上网是看到的各大网页、官方网站、以及个人网站就是web前端。

Web前端开发工程师就要是通过(X)HTML/CSS/JavaScript/Flash等各种Web技术进行客户端产品的开发。完成浏览器端的开发,开发Flash和JavaScript,并结合后台开发技术模拟整体的效果,进行互联网的web开发并提高用户体验。

web前端开发工程师必须要精通 CSS、XHTML/HTML,熟悉页面结构和布局,对于web的标签语义化以及标签要有深刻的理解。

对jQuery、YUI等常用的一些JS框架了解。

掌握最基本的JavaScript计算方法编写。

对目前互联网流行的网页制作方法(Web2.0)HTML+CSS

各个浏览器兼容性有很大的了解。

对HTML5+CSS3前沿技术的基本掌握。

对IT其他编程语言PHP,Java,.net!有所了解

有一些公司还要求懂一点SEO优化!

三、WebStorm 有哪些过人之处

WebStorm过人之处自带的版本控制,优秀的代码定位能力,能轻松将光标定位到变量属性方法的定义处,对阅读代码非常有用。聪明的代码联想、格式化功能。可定制的code template,加强版的zen coding,而且不仅限于html和css。 svn、git等版本工具的支持,内置的 gist非常方便。 nodejs最好的开发工具,预处理语言的支持,使less、sass、cofeescript等等语言的自动编译变得很简单。 remote host和live edit的组合使用,让直接编辑远程文件并实时刷新,一下省去了保存本地文件,上传本地文件到远程服务器,刷新浏览器。